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A system includes a controller and a robotic arm. The controller accesses an image signal of an udder of a dairy livestock, and determines a spray position by processing the accessed image signal to determine a tangent at the rear of the udder and a tangent at the bottom of the udder. The spray position is a position relative to the intersection of the two tangents. A robotic arm communicatively coupled to the controller positions a spray tool at the spray position.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A system, comprising: a controller operable to: access an image signal of an udder of a dairy livestock; and determine a spray position by processing the accessed image signal to determine a tangent at the rear of the udder and a tangent at the bottom of the udder, the spray position being a position relative to the intersection of the two tangents; and a robotic arm communicatively coupled to the controller and operable to position a spray tool at the spray position. 2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the spray tool is operable to apply disinfectant to one or more teats of the dairy livestock. 3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the image signal comprises a three-dimensional video image signal. 4. The system of claim 1 , wherein the controller is further operable to determine positions of each of two hind legs of the dairy livestock by processing the accessed image signal to locate edges in depth, the edges in depth corresponding to the edges of the hind legs of the dairy livestock. 5. The system of claim 4 , wherein the controller is further operable to determine a position of an udder of the dairy livestock by processing the accessed image signal to trace one or more of the located edges in depth upwardly until they intersect with the udder. 6. The system of claim 1 , wherein the robotic arm is operable to extend between the hind legs of the dairy livestock such that the spray tool is located at the spray position.
